The Senator Paul Simon Water for the Poor Act of 2005 made access to safe water and sanitation for developing countries a U.S. foreign assistance policy objective. The U.S. provides such assistance mainly through the USAID. The Act requires the Secretary of State to develop a water and sanitation assistance strategy with the USAID, and designate high-priority countries for assistance. This report: (1) describes USAID's accomplishments; (2) describes USAID's obligations of funds for water and sanitation assistance in FY 2006-09; (3) assesses the Dept. of State's (State) development of a U.S. water and sanitation strategy; and (4) examines State's designation of high-priority countries. Includes recommendations. Charts and tables.
